0 Source: stackoverflow.com. T translate or move shapes around. Find out in this tutorial. In the above flutter animation i have simply gave an anim effect to an image where an image size gets increase within 3 seconds from Container height 0 to 100. To get the animation effect we use the AnimatedSize. All of the buttons in the radial menu will be stacked on top of each other, then animated around the center when the menu is opened. You can use this icon on the same way in your project. These tasks represent the skills you need to have in Flare to re-create Giphy's animated icons. Add a Grepper Answer . Add drop shadow to the container. First, we need to create some awesome animated graphics with Flare. So, in this article, we will learn to smoothly animate/move the marker from one location to another. In Flutter we have different kinds of Icons that we can use for free to create a beautiful app UI. but if you need 3D kind of effect you have to setEntry method. Many widgets, especially Material widgets , come with the standard motion effects defined in their design spec, but it's also possible to customize these effects. . ScaleTransition. Trong hàm builder, trả về một widget icon được bọc trong widget Transform.rotate (). Our Flutter Galaxy will spin slightly faster than that. Flutter: Rotate Icon by 90 degrees Raw flutter_icon_rotate.dart This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. The generation of numbers is tied to the screen refresh, so typically 60 . For more information about Flutter. Using the Animated Rotation Widget we can control two properties. So we will block that rotation for the previous widget ( only ) to animate. Below is the demo of the app that we are going to build. Flutter Icons, List- Get All latest Flutter icons- Use Easily- Fluttericons - Flutter Icons, List- Get All latest Flutter icons- Use Easily- Fluttericons Get User icon, Search Icon, You can quickly access the Flutter icons list on this page, just copy & paste the icon classes to add any icon in your flutter app. Hence, our tween would be: . In here I am gone a show you how to make nice button animation using Flutter animation. We will get output like the below: Roated Box Widget. License. Partly inspired by the amazing Animate.css package by Dan Eden. Animated version of Align which automatically transitions the child's position over a given duration whenever the given alignment changes. A quick video demonstrating the important concepts of animation in Flutter.Ready to learn more? Flutter's Transform widget has a named constructor Transform.rotate that allows you to easily rotate a widget. Coding a real-world Flutter animation. AnimatedOpacity, a widget for creating animation when the opacity of a widget changes. flutter transform rotate . Using the value option, we can set the initial size of the widget you're going to animate. We would also give the functionality of app user to start and stop rotation animation using animationController.repeat () and animationController.stop () method. Dart answers related to "rotate IconButton flutter" flutter raised button with icon; flutter block rotation; Round button with text and icon in flutter; How do I rotate widget in flutter? When working with Flutter, adding this animation isn't straightforward as Google map SDK for Flutter does not provide any inbuilt method to implement this. I don't know - but maybe it . Example 1 - Basic (no animation) App Preview. AnimatedIcon class - material library - Dart API description AnimatedIcon class Null safety Shows an animated icon at a given animation progress. assignment 1. AnimatedIcon (Flutter Widget of the Week) link assignment An implicitly animated version of RotationTransition which automatically transitions the rotation over time when the provided angle changes. The below demo video shows how to make a spinning animation in a flutter. AnimatedSwitcher, a widget for creating animation when switching between two widgets. Null safety: For null safety please use flutter_animator: ^3.1.0, without null safety: flutter_animator: 2.1.0. Static Icons: In static there are 2 kinds of those are. An implicitly animated version of RotationTransition which automatically transitions the rotation over time when the provided angle changes. animationController = AnimationController (vsync: this, duration: Duration (seconds: 5), upperBound: pi * 2); Consider a code snippet . and same when I press the expand_less then it should become expand_more with rotating animation. MIT . Animation is a complex procedure in any mobile application. To start an animation, you need to change one of the property values. Using Transform.rotate. For more information about Flutter. The screen has an app bar and a Center widget to put the animation on the screen. Animates the scale of . If we put the 3 distinct animations on a timeline, we obtain: If we now consider the intervals of values, for each of the 3 animations, we get: moveLeftToCenter. below is my code : . Or, 2 seconds. First we will show four buttons so we can perform each animation in separate screen on click. I used Text and rotated it with 45 ˚ ( π/4 ). Start the animation by rebuilding with new properties. It gives the rotation in clockwise radians. When the code is successfully run, we will show four rectangle boxes that will rotate clockwise that is a spinning animation, and the user will stop/play the animation . This example rotates an orange box containing text around its center by fifteen degrees. All the languages codes are included in this website. Animate and rotate an Image Widget by 90 degrees in Flutter by using a Transform Rotation Animation.Click here to Subscribe to Johannes Milke: https://www.yo. Once you have the controller, you can use a bool to store the rotation direction and an Animation controlled by the Animation controller to rotate the widget. Learning by example is one of the most effective learning methods, especially in web and mobile development. Finally, call methods on the AnimationController to start/stop animation. Check it out on DartPad. In this article, we will gonna do How to Animate the Page when sliding. Here i am setting the container height from 0 - 100 in 3 seconds. The most complicated part of the Flutter logo animation was rotation of the middle beam. flutter rotate animation icon on press . The above button as four widgets in the row which is the child of the animated container class. 2. ; Animation<double> turns *: The animation that controls the rotation of the child. As the name itself suggests, rotate animation is responsible for causing rotation in a button, icon or anything else. Get started. There are free and paid both icons available. FloatingActionButton; FloatingActionButton.extended The Lottie.network () takes the URL of the JSON animation file and renders the animation. Interactive example. Consider a code snippet like below: Widget build (BuildContext context) { return Transform.rotate (angle: - math.pi / 4, child: Text ("Text"),); } So we will get the output like below: Key key: The widget's key, used to control if it should be replaced. If we . All the languages codes are included in this website. Due to its richness, animation becomes an integral part of modern mobile application. R rotate shapes. Install Get it from pub. It works in a percentage of rotation, if you turn it into degrees, it will be 0.0 = 0deg, 1.0 = 360deg double turns = 0.0; It's important to create that controller on the initState () method, and dispose it on the dispose () method to prevent possible errors. Firstly, the middle beam is approaching from the bottom left. duration: 2 seconds, begins at 0 second, ends at 2 seconds => range = [0;2] => percentages: from 0% to 20% of the whole scene => [0.0;0.20] moveCenterToTop. What am i doing wrong ? flutter. First, we'll see very simple rotation animation. First make sure you have added Material Icon library. To build a simple application depicting the use of page_transition package for a Rotate transition follow the below steps: Add page_transition to the dependencies in pubspec.yaml file Import the same dependency in the main.dart file Use a StatelessWidget to give a structure to the application Design the homepage You can see the target example, down here…. As a result, the Image Widget as its Child Widget rotates clockwise. The generation of numbers is tied to the screen refresh, so typically 60 . changes the shape, size, position and orientation) its child widget before painting it. 1. Transform.rotate ( angle: -math.pi / 12.0 , child: Container . We can do that with the help of Transform Widget. Then while the top edge is touching the bottom (dark) leg, the rotations around this edge starts. Creating an AnimationController One of the easiest ways to get an Animation<double> is to create an AnimationController, which is a. typescript by SeriousMonk on Jan 22 2022 Comment . The Container class provides a convenient way to create a widget with specific properties: width, height, background color, padding, borders, and more. Animation possible using AnimatedIcon. Build an AnimatedContainer using the properties. You can get different-different varients like outline, filled, sharp, rounded and two-tone. Interactive example. The Tween defines the values that will change over the course of the animation. GF Flutter Rotation Animation. Flutter offers two types of FloatingActionButtons out-of-the-box. It might be for 1 seconds. Learn more Help improve Flutter! These widgets are collectively referred to as implicit animations , or implicitly animated widgets, deriving their name from the ImplicitlyAnimatedWidget class that they . . GFAnimation is a Flutter Animation wherein it makes the UI smooth for the user and the user interaction with the app will be easier.GFAnimation makes it easy to implement a variety of animations.. GF Flutter Animation Type : 1. Flutter's animation support makes it easy to implement a variety of animation types. 2. dependencies: animated_rotation: ^1.0.0 Run flutter pub get in your root folder after saving the pubspec.yaml . Lottie files are a straightforward Flutter application with just one page. To review, open the file in an editor that reveals hidden Unicode characters. SizeTransition, a widget that animates its own size and clips and aligns its child. Transform widget can use to add a different transform to child widget. Add the dependency to your pubspec.yaml. A sample video is given below to get an idea about what we are going to do in this article. expand, 3 children: . API reference. Enables you to create stunning flutter animations, faster, efficient and with less code. The seamless transition of switching between icons can . Creates a widget that transforms its child using a rotation around the center. It will be shown on your device. The Flutter and Dart teams are hiring. Rotations Permalink. visit www.fluttertutorial.in Firstly, we can decide the duration. . In this flutter example, we are displaying scale, rotate, skew and translate animations with image on click of button. Create a StatefulWidget with default properties. Create home_screen.dart file and copy the following code inside it In initState () method, _arrowAnimationController is initialised with duration of animation equal to 300 milliseconds. Documentation. AnimationController derives from Animation<double>, so it can be used wherever an Animation object is needed. So, to rotate by 90 degrees, you need to multiply . Create a free account, then complete the tasks below. Flutter framework recognizes the importance of Animation . Before get started so let's breakdown what are the things need to do. How can I acheive this ? After defining our animation controller, we would need to rotate the square from 0.0 to 3.14 (pi) radians, making it go full circle. It can take a child widget and an animation that controls the rotation of that child: RotationTransition( turns: _animation, child: /* Your widget here */ } You can create an infinitely spinning animation as follows: // Create a controller late final AnimationController _controller = AnimationController( duration: const Duration(seconds: 2 . Create a StatefulWidget with default properties. This is a plugin with the help of which you can animate between any two icons like we do in AnimatedIcon widget given to us by default. Start the animation by rebuilding with new properties. flutter animated icon; flutter get a MaterialColor from rgb; flutter unload screen from stack; refresh screen flutter; flutter navigate to new page without back; change text in text feild flutter; flutter column in listview not working; flutter custom appbar; empty a textfield after submit flutter; flutter textformfield reset; listview in . Adding that kind of animation to flutter app is pretty easy. The Transform.rotate gives the rotation in clockwise radians. Flutter Animation Effect Example 1. Location On Icon is given below. Then, at the middle of the animation, the rotation of pi/2 makes the widget's width to 0.0. Install. It's not a simple rotation by x or y axis. We are using Transform.rotate () property of AnimationController to rotate image view. See the example below: Rotate Widget with Transform.rotate(): When the code is successfully run, we will show four rectangle boxes that will rotate clockwise that is a spinning animation, and the user will stop/play the animation when pressing the floating action button. What if you need to display a widget rotated at a certain degree or radian. Flutter - Animation. Flutter Animation with tutorial and examples on HTML, CSS, JavaScript, XHTML, Java, .Net, PHP, C, C++, Python, JSP, Spring, Bootstrap, jQuery, Interview Questions etc. If you set it to 0.5, the it will be at the scale of 0.5 of its original size when the animation begins. FloatingActionButton - Animated FloatingActionButton in Flutter Published April 17, 2020. Lottie is a mobile library that parses Adobe After Effects animations exported as json with Bodymovin and renders them natively on mobile!. Transform widget to the rescue A Transform widget "transforms" (i.e. Page View is a list that works page by page. Material Icon: Icon (Icons.add,size:100); Cupertino Icon: Icon (CupertinoIcon.moon_stars,size:100); So with both this flutter static icons i.e. Add the dependency to your pubspec.yaml. GFAnimation property type: GFAnimationType.rotateTransition, creates a rotation transition for the child of type widget. ; Alignment alignment: The alignment of the coordinate system's origin relative to the size of the box where the rotation will occur around which.Defaults to Alignment.center. Change the drop shadow spread radius.
Being Proud Of Yourself In Islam, Why Does Trevor Richards Have Grey Hair, Splash Mountain Drop Angle, Xq Nyc Youth Advisors Internship, Daniel Miller Son Of Arthur Miller, Barcelona Harbor Westfield, Ny,